** The Acura repair market in the greater Charleston, WV area is moderately competitive but lacks a dedicated Acura-only dealership. This creates a niche for high-quality independent shops that can handle the technical sophistication of the brand. The average quality of service is good, with a handful of shops, like those listed, rising to the top through specialized training and tooling. Competition is not saturated, but it is fierce for the relatively small number of Acura owners in the region. Shops that succeed are those that have invested in the specific diagnostic equipment (such as Honda/Acura HDS) and have technicians with proven experience on platforms like SH-AWD and VTEC. Typical pricing is in line with national averages for specialized independent shops, generally 20-30% lower than what a dealership would charge for similar work. Labor rates typically range from $115 to $140 per hour. For very specialized procedures, particularly ADAS calibrations following a windshield replacement or collision repair, owners may need to travel to a dedicated collision center or a dealership in a larger city like Huntington or Beckley.
